I am trying to load a new Beckhoff PLC with existing code that was written by a coworker. I would ask the coworker how to do it but he's no longer with the company. Anyway, I have loaded the configuration file and the code. I am using TwinCAT software and using Beckhoff PLC CX1100.
I can see the inputs fine but I can't toggle the output bits. Do I need to map the output bits to the hardware? I thought that the existing congifuration file has that information saved? If I go into the System Manager, I can see the list of outputs if I collapse CX1100-KB.
I'm still new to PLCs and I'm learning as I go. Is there a procedure out there with steps on how to load PLC software onto the PLC? Perhaps I am missing a step in loading existing software? Any help or suggestions would be greatly appreciated.

We had to have a spare PLC in our 7 PLC sysetm but it had to be useable with different code sets. I asked our Beckhoff Technical Support whetehr we could just copy and keep 7 spare Compact Flashes and the said no - but maybe this was a Microsoft/TwinCAT licensing issue.
If you do clone the CF you may wish to change the IP address if the two PLCs are to be used in the same domain. The IP address is stored in the CF I'm sure.
I'm surprised that the MAC ID was copied across as I thought that would be in the ethernet firmware - but I've never confirmed this. MAC ID is printed on the PLC I think so I thought it was fixed. EthernetRT connection might be worth checking if you're using it.
